Four-Way Tie Leads Opening Round of Mexico Riviera Maya Open

Pagdanganan, Iwai, Shin, and Do each shot 4-under 68 in challenging heat at El Camaleon Golf Course.

Overview

  • Bianca Pagdanganan, Chisato Iwai, Jenny Shin, and Brianna Do share the lead after the first round, each carding a 4-under 68.
  • Sweltering heat and humidity on the Yucatán Peninsula tested players' endurance and limited scoring opportunities.
  • Pagdanganan capitalized on her power game, finishing with a two-putt birdie on the par-5 18th hole.
  • Brianna Do, making her first LPGA appearance of the year, overcame a challenging track record to secure a share of the lead.
  • Five players, including Hye-Jin Choi and Jenny Bae, sit one stroke back at 3-under, while top-ranked Charley Hull struggled to a 72.
